I work in a variety of media, drawing on my interests in pattern, language, and textile practices from around the world. Thread is a central element in my work, lending it both physical and metaphorical structure. I completed a BFA in painting at the Massachusetts College of Art and an MFA in fibers from the Tyler School of Art, Temple University, as well as earning degrees in Spanish literature and linguistics from UCLA. My work has been exhibited widely, and I have been awarded several fellowships, including a Career Development Fellowship from the Center for Emerging Visual Artists in Philadelphia. I have taught at Tyler School of Art, and have led workshops in a variety of settings, including the Philadelphia Museum of Art and RISD’s Continuing Education program.
